1. Lower Your Credit Utilization (Instant Impact)
-
Goal: Get balances below 10% of your credit limit (30% is okay, but 10% is ideal).
-
How:
-
Pay down cards before the statement date (when issuers report to bureaus).
-
Ask for a credit limit increase (lowers utilization %).
-
-
Potential gain: 20-50 points in 1 billing cycle.
2. Dispute Credit Report Errors (Free & Quick)
-
25% of reports have mistakes (late payments that weren’t late, duplicate accounts).
-
How to fix:
-
Get free reports at AnnualCreditReport.com.
-
Dispute errors via Credit Karma or directly with Experian, Equifax, TransUnion.
-
-
Potential gain: 40+ points if a major error is removed.
3. Become an Authorized User (Instant History Boost)
-
Get added to a trusted person’s old, high-limit, low-balance card.
-
Best picks: A parent or spouse with 10+ years of perfect payments.
-
Warning: Only works if the card issuer reports authorized users (Amex, Chase, Citi do).
-
Potential gain: 50+ points if added to a pristine account.
4. Use Experian Boost (Free & Instant)
-
Experian Boost adds utility/phone payments to your credit file.
-
Potential gain: 10-30 points (best for thin credit files).

5. Pay Off Collections Under $100
-
FICO 9 & newer models ignore paid collections.
-
Even old models see “paid” as better than “unpaid.”
-
Potential gain: 20-60 points (if collector agrees to delete).
6. Get a Credit-Builder Loan
-
Self Lender or Credit Strong reports payments to all 3 bureaus.
-
How it works: You “borrow” money but only get it after repaying.
-
Potential gain: 30-70 points over 6 months.

🚫 What NOT to Do (Credit Score Killers)
❌ Close old credit cards (shortens credit history).
❌ Max out cards (even if you pay in full, high utilization hurts).
❌ Apply for multiple credit cards/loans at once (hard inquiries drop scores 5-10 pts each).
❌ Miss payments (even 1 late payment can tank your score 60-100 pts).
